I would try searching for this, but I have no clue what to look for.
My interior lights don't come on when I open the doors. If I'm inside the car, with the car on, the dome lights are dimly lit, and my clock is off. If I click one light off, my clock turns on dimly and my idiot cluster flashes, if I click both lights off, my clock works as normal.
I don't care about my clock, I'd just like to get my dome lights to work. I'm assuming there is a short somewhere between the idiot cluster/dome light area but I'd like another opinion before ripping into it all.

Have you opened up the dome light?
On my otherwise pristine S5 chassis, the dome light was majorly corroded- looked like it came from the Titanic.
The door switches are easy to check as well.
And look at the ROOM fuse.

Previous owner decided to shove a 10amp fuse in that spot, and also run a wire going to the aftermarket stereo under it. Funny part is the dude owned a huge car audio shop in his town......
All works now except the dome light, but I think it's just burnt out. Good time to go all LEDs
